Message type: E = Error
Message class: 29 - Bills of Material
Message number: 753
Message text: BOM for functional location & & is not valid on &
You want to display the BOM for functional location &V1& in plant &V2&
and have enter the date &V3& in the <LS>Valid from</> field.
You cannot process the BOM, as the BOM is not valid on this date.
To display the BOM over its entire validity period, proceed as follows:
Choose <LS>Functional loc. BOM -> Display</>.
Enter the special character "!" at the beginning of the fields
<LS>Valid from</> and <LS>Valid to</>.

- BOM for functional location & & is not valid on & ?The SAP error message "29753 BOM for functional location & & is not valid on &" typically indicates that there is an issue with the Bill of Materials (BOM) associated with a specific functional location in the SAP system. This error can occur in various scenarios, such as during maintenance planning, work order creation, or when trying to access BOM data for a functional location.
Cause:
- Invalid BOM Assignment: The BOM may not be correctly assigned to the functional location, or it may not exist for the specified date.
- Date Validity: The BOM might not be valid for the date you are trying to access it. BOMs have validity periods, and if the date falls outside this range, the system will throw this error.
- Inactive BOM: The BOM could be inactive or not released for use.
- Configuration Issues: There may be configuration issues in the system that prevent the BOM from being recognized for the functional location.
Solution:
Check BOM Validity: Verify the validity dates of the BOM. Ensure that the BOM is valid for the date you are trying to access it. You can do this by checking the BOM in the BOM management transaction (e.g., CS03).
BOM Assignment: Ensure that the BOM is correctly assigned to the functional location. You can check this in the functional location master data (transaction IL03) to see if the BOM is linked properly.
Activate/Release BOM: If the BOM is inactive, you may need to activate or release it. This can be done in the BOM management transaction.
Create or Update BOM: If the BOM does not exist for the functional location, you may need to create a new BOM or update the existing one to include the functional location.
Check Configuration: If the issue persists, check the configuration settings related to BOMs and functional locations in the SAP system. Ensure that all necessary settings are correctly configured.
Consult Documentation: Refer to SAP documentation or help resources for more detailed troubleshooting steps related to BOMs and functional locations.
